              The Types of Story Board Sessions. There are two types of
              story board sessions: creative-thinking sessions and critical-
              thinking sessions. They take place for each of the four types
              of story boards—planning, ideas, organization, and
              communication.

              Rules for a Creative Thinking Session: During the creative-
              thinking session the objective is to come up with as many
              ideas and solutions as possible. You follow the basic
              brainstorming rules: Consider all ideas relevant, no matter
              how impractical and farfetched they may seem; the more
              ideas that arise, the better; no criticism is allowed at this point;
              hitchhike on each others' ideas and keep comments short.
              (There will be an evaluation session following the creativity
              session.) Each creative-thinking session should last no longer
              than an hour (ideally thirty to forty minutes) to maintain
              maximum interest and effectiveness. The critical-thinking
              session that follows can be roughly twice as long.

              Rules for a Critical Thinking Session: After the planning
              board has been completed to the group's satisfaction, take a
              break. Now you're ready for a critical-thinking session.
              During the critical-thinking session the ideas and solutions
              generated in the creative-thinking session are evaluated.
              Now is the time to think judgmentally.
